A computer is something that computes, and since humans make computations when processing information, humans are computers. What kinds of computations do humans make when they learn languages? Answering this question requires the collaborative efforts of researchers in several different disciplines and sub-disciplines, including language science (e.g. theoretical linguistics, psycholinguistics, language acquisition), computer science, psychology, and cognitive science. The primary purpose of this chapter is explain to developmental psycholinguists and language scientists more generally, the main conclusions and issues in computational learning theories. Computational Psycholinguistics

Computational psycholinguistics seeks to build theories of human linguistic processes that take the form of working computational models. These models address processes ranging from word recognition to discourse comprehension, and produce behaviour that constitutes predictions to be compared to human data.
